About This Airport
Jolo Airport is located in the Philippines and serves Jolo Island in the Sulu Archipelago. While it mainly handles domestic flights, it may accommodate limited general aviation operations. Tourists visiting Jolo can explore its cultural heritage, historical landmarks, and natural attractions, as well as enjoy water-based activities such as diving and snorkeling in the coral reefs of the Sulu Sea.
